Output 02c168cbba09814aa0c8acaaa83f211ffa0a30c758c00910ed75d1dcac5c6119:10

value
21129904
script pubkey
OP_0 OP_PUSHBYTES_20 6d0279efc876efeedfe596d1b74e202001a65d17
address
bc1qd5p8nm7gwmh7ahl9jmgmwn3qyqq6vhgh74vr4f
transaction
02c168cbba09814aa0c8acaaa83f211ffa0a30c758c00910ed75d1dcac5c6119
confirmations
289444
spent
true